#0c707c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0c707c is composed of 4.7% red, 43.9%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.3% cyan, 9.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 186.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.4% and a lightness of 26.7%. #0c707c color hex could be obtained by blending #18e0f8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#0c707c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020f11 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0c707c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#404748 is the less saturated color, while #027886 is the most saturated one.
